Hot Water Heater Repair in Fort Lauderdale, FL
Hot water heater repair services address issues related to malfunctioning or failing water heating units in residential properties. These projects typically involve diagnosing problems such as no hot water, inconsistent temperature, leaks, or strange noises, and then performing necessary repairs to restore proper function. Property owners often seek assistance with both traditional tank-based water heaters and tankless systems, ensuring their homes maintain reliable hot water supply for daily needs.
Before requesting hot water heater repair, homeowners should understand the type and age of their unit, as well as any specific symptoms or issues experienced. Knowing the make and model can help facilitate accurate diagnosis and efficient service. Additionally, property owners may want to inquire about the scope of repairs covered, potential replacement options if repairs are no longer viable, and any maintenance recommendations to prevent future problems.

Common Hot Water Heater Repair Jobs
Hot Water Heater Repair - restores proper function to ensure reliable hot water supply.
Thermostat Troubleshooting - fixes temperature control issues to prevent inconsistent water heating.
Leak Detection and Repair - addresses leaks that can cause water damage and reduce efficiency.
Heating Element Replacement - restores heating performance for consistent hot water output.
Sediment Flush Services - removes buildup that can impair heater performance and lifespan.
Emergency Repair Services - provides prompt solutions for sudden water heater failures.
Hot Water Heater Repair Questions
What are common signs of a hot water heater needing repair? Signs include inconsistent water temperature, strange noises, leaks, or a lack of hot water during use.
Can a hot water heater be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many issues can be fixed through repairs, depending on the age and condition of the unit.
What should property owners do if their hot water heater is leaking? It's important to contact a professional promptly to assess and address the leak to prevent water damage.
How can property owners prevent future hot water heater problems? Regular maintenance and inspections can help identify issues early and extend the lifespan of the unit.
